Teacher

My Teacher A shepherd of many, a shepherd in all times An intelligent shepherd, a shepherd with great minds Sacrificing and overlooking all your rights You raise a simple mind to greater heights Many great lives you make, by lighting up their life rights Education and wisdom you share making us bright My teacher, I may not pay you back, but your final reward is great Your work is not just a profession, but a calling Holding our lives and protecting them from falling Your sacrifice for us and pains you underwent is what we are enjoying As we sit down, we praise, thank and appreciate you in our thinking The joy and gratitude we have in our hearts for you is overwhelming My teacher, I many not pay you back but your final reward is great Cold mornings, freezing nights and at all times you are with us Holding everything aside, you care for us learners Not expecting payment from us students you sacrifice for us Not only in academics and career, but even talent you natures From the land of illiterate, naive and uncivilized you removed us In the territory of the learned, bright and wise you placed us You are guardian angel, a parent away from home My teacher, I may not pay you back but you reward is great (By Waweru Ngugi)
